Transaction 589dd0d417dcafd07c893980bceb79d9108df727552d3a6f64980016a84427c9
1 Input
1 Output
-
589dd0d417dcafd07c893980bceb79d9108df727552d3a6f64980016a84427c9:0
- value
- 1811538
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e95251e6ad00587d9e18d42030221e2ca8d24a2c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NGh4PLu1Bp1zRARXhYzri93PweabYEQcV